About Aio Wireless

Aio Wireless used to be a prepaid wireless service provider in the US, that now is a wholly owned subsidiary of AT&T Inc. Aio Wireless offered its services using AT&T Mobility's nationwide GSM, HSPA+, and LTE wireless networks. Their data plans offered a maximum download speed of 8 Mbit/s using LTE, and 4 Mbit/s using HSPA+ . In 2014, Aio Wireless merged with Cricket Wireless, due to an acquisition deal made by AT&T and Leap Wireless who is parent of Cricket Wireless. AT&T, Aio and Cricket soon after announced that the New Cricket would work on Aio's current wireless network.
